A Journey through the Unique Cultural Elements of White America
White Americans have diverse cultures that vary based on geographic location and religious background. For example, in the northeast, there are white Catholics who have a diet of red meat and potatoes, while in the south, there are evangelicals and Baptists who enjoy biscuits and gravy and chicken fried steak. These regional differences contribute to the rich tapestry of white American culture.
American culture, including white American culture, is rich and diverse, encompassing elements such as drive-thrus, NFL, swing music, baseball, heavy metal, pop, Hollywood, diners, and high school/college sports. These cultural elements have become synonymous with American identity and have had a significant impact on the global stage.
Culture is not solely determined by race but is more closely correlated with geographic proximity. While white culture may have roots in European heritage and religions, its persistence and evolution depend on exposure and location. Immigrants from different European countries brought their unique traditions and customs, which have blended with American ideals to create a distinct white American culture.
